在数字内容创作领域,渲染环节往往是制约项目效率与质量的瓶颈。随着三维动画、影视特效、建筑可视化及游戏资产等内容的复杂度和精度不断提升,单台工作站甚至小型服务器集群已难以满足大规模、高强度的渲染需求。在此背景下,渲染农场作为一种集中化、规模化的分布式计算解决方案,逐渐成为行业标配。本文将从技术架构的深层剖析出发,结合其多样化的应用场景,探讨现代渲染农场如何实现从云端协作到高效渲染的无缝衔接。
渲染农场的核心,在于其分布式计算架构。传统意义上的“农场”,形象地描绘了将海量渲染任务(即“农活”)分发给众多计算节点(即“农夫”)并行处理的模式。现代渲染农场的技术栈已高度专业化与复杂化。其基础硬件层通常由数以千计的高性能计算节点构成,每个节点配备多核CPU、大容量高速内存,并普遍搭载专业级GPU,以应对光线追踪等对并行计算要求极高的渲染引擎。这些节点通过高带宽、低延迟的网络(如InfiniBand或高速以太网)互联,并与集中式的共享存储系统(如NAS或SAN)相连,确保所有节点能够快速访问统一的项目资产与纹理数据,这是实现并行渲染一致性的基石。
在软件与管理层,渲染农场依赖于一套精密的作业调度与管理系统。这套系统如同农场的中枢神经,负责接收用户提交的渲染任务,对其进行智能解析、依赖检查、资源分配与队列调度。优秀的调度器能够动态平衡各节点的负载,优先处理紧急任务,并具备容错机制——当某个节点出现故障时,能自动将其中断的任务重新分配给其他健康节点,保障整体作业流的连续性。与主流三维创作软件(如Maya、3ds Max、Cinema 4D)及渲染器(如V-Ray、Arnold、Redshift)的深度集成插件,使得艺术家能够直接从创作界面提交任务、监控进度并取回结果,极大简化了工作流程。
近年来,渲染农场的部署模式发生了显著演进,云端化成为主流趋势。云端渲染农场不再要求用户自建并维护庞大的实体机房,而是通过互联网按需调用云服务商提供的海量计算资源。这种模式带来了革命性的优势:首先是极致的弹性伸缩能力,在项目赶工或需要渲染超高分辨率序列时,可以瞬间调动数千甚至上万个核芯进行冲刺,任务完成后立即释放资源,真正实现了按使用量付费,降低了企业的固定设施投入与运维成本。云端架构天然支持跨地域协作,分布在世界各地的团队成员可以随时上传资产、提交渲染并下载成果,为全球化制作团队提供了无缝协作平台。安全方面,正规的云渲染服务会提供数据加密传输、存储隔离、渲染后自动清理等保障措施,以应对项目资产的保密性要求。
渲染农场的应用场景早已超越早期的影视特效领域,呈现出高度的多元化。在影视动画行业,它用于处理电影级品质的动画长片和视觉特效镜头,将原本需要单机数月完成的渲染工作缩短至数天。建筑、工程与施工领域,利用渲染农场快速生成高真实感的静态效果图、全景漫游以及光照分析动画,助力设计展示与方案决策。游戏开发中,农场不仅用于烘焙光照贴图、计算全局光照等资源制作,也越来越多地用于生成宣传CG与过场动画。甚至在新兴的虚拟制作领域,实时引擎虽已承担大部分工作,但某些高质量背景板仍需离线渲染农场预先制作。科学可视化、工业设计仿真等领域也对渲染计算有着稳定需求。
要充分发挥渲染农场的效能,也面临一些技术挑战与考量。网络带宽是云端渲染的生命线,大量原始素材的上传与最终成品的下载时间可能成为新的瓶颈,需要优化资产管理与增量传输策略。成本控制同样关键,用户需在渲染速度、画面质量(采样率等)与费用之间找到最佳平衡点,避免不必要的资源浪费。软件许可管理是另一复杂议题,尤其是对于按节点授权的渲染器,需要在浮动许可管理与成本间进行周密规划。
展望未来,渲染农场的技术发展将与计算图形学的前沿紧密互动。随着实时光线追踪硬件的普及与渲染算法的进步,传统离线渲染与实时渲染的界限正在模糊,未来农场可能会演变为支持混合渲染模式的“智能计算池”。人工智能的引入也值得期待,例如通过AI预测渲染时间、智能优化渲染参数、甚至辅助进行降噪与分辨率提升,从而进一步提升效率与资源利用率。同时,随着算力需求的持续爆炸性增长,绿色计算与降低功耗也将成为渲染农场设计的重要考量因素。
现代渲染农场通过其高度协同的分布式技术架构与灵活弹性的云端部署模式,已深度融入数字内容生产的核心流程。它不仅仅是一个简单的“算力批发市场”,更是一个集成了项目管理、资源调度、流程自动化与协同工作的综合性平台。从个人艺术家到大型工作室,渲染农场都已成为将创意构想高效、精准地转化为视觉现实不可或缺的基础设施,持续推动着整个视觉工业的产能边界与创意表达极限。
原创文章,作者:XiaoWen,如若转载,请注明出处:https://www.zhujizhentan.com/a/5247